Stanford GSB – Stanford Africa MBA Fellowship

May 28 By Samuel Leave a Comment

  • Stanford Graduate School of Business contributes to Africa’s human and economic development by educating leaders who are committed to making a significant impact on the continent.

Scholarship Overview

  • The Stanford Africa MBA Fellowship encourages individuals who would never have thought it possible to study abroad to apply for this opportunity to attend the Stanford GSB.
  • Stanford Africa MBA Fellows are required to return to their home countries within two years of graduation from the Stanford GSB and work for at least two years in a professional role that directly contributes to the continent’s development.
  • This MBA Fellowship targets citizens of African countries who are unable to pay for their education.

Host School(s)

  • Stanford Graduate School of Business

Field(s) of Study

  • Masters in Business Administration (MBA)

What does the scholarship cover?

  • The full cost of Stanford MBA tuition
  • All fees associated with the course (up to US$ 170,000)
  • Room, board and other living expenses for recipients who demonstrate additional financial need in their applications

How many scholarships are given?

  • Up to 8 fellowships are given out every year.

Which countries are targeted?

  • Citizens of African countries
  • Dual citizens are also welcome to apply, as long as they hold citizenship of an African nation.

Am I Eligible to Apply?

The following conditions apply to anyone interested in this scholarship:

  • You must have completed, or be in the final stages of completing your undergraduate studies, preferably at an institution in Africa.
  • Students who have taken their first degree outside Africa are also eligible.
  • You must be a citizen of an African country.
  • You must return to work in Africa within two years of graduation, and remain employed in your country of origin for two years.
  • You must show attributes worthy of a Stanford MBA Fellow, including leadership potential, intellectual prowess, and personal qualities that contribute positively to the class.
  • You must commit to using the leadership and management skills learned at Stanford to improve the African economy.
  • You must demonstrate financial need based on the personal financial information you put in your application.

How do I Apply – Next Steps

To apply for this scholarship, please follow the steps below.

  1. Application process
  • You will be asked to provide the following with your scholarship application;
    • Educational history – An unofficial transcript from your university will suffice. Official copies of your transcripts will be required only when you are accepted into the MBA program. You may also submit results of the GMAT (Graduate Management Admission Test) or GRE (Graduate Record Examination) at this stage. Note that the results of either of these tests will also be required for your MBA application.
    • Any awards and honors (academic, personal or professional)
    • Employment history – Although letters of recommendation are not necessary at this stage, you will need two of them for your MBA application.
    • A one-page resume or curriculum vitae (CV)
    • A 250-word essay addressing how you intend to make an impact in Africa
    • Individual financial information
  1. Notification
  • A maximum of 100 finalists will be chosen for the Stanford Africa MBA Fellowship
  • Notification will take place on 30 July 2018
  1. All finalists apply for the Stanford MBA program
  • All Fellowship finalists must apply to the Stanford MBA program in either round one or round two. Submitting your application in round one works to your advantage, as competition is stiff in round two. Also, if you apply in round one, you get more time to prepare your application.
  • The MBA application should be submitted together with GMAT or GRE scores, and results for one of the English language tests (IELTS, PTE, TOEFL), if applicable.
  • Finalists can request up to one voucher to cover the cost of the GMAT or GRE test.
  • The MBA course application fee will be waived or finalists.
  1. Receive an offer of admission
  • The Stanford GSB will select up to eight MBA fellows out of the 100 finalists.

Note: The application fee for the Stanford MBA Program is US$275. Please note that the application fee is waived for applicants who are making a salary that is equal to or less than US$20,000. Once you apply, you will receive more information on the currency conversion rate, and how this is calculated.

Closing Date

  • The closing date is 7 June 2018, at 5:00 PM (Pacific Time).
